It’s Homecoming Week at Valparaiso University!

The Victory Bell: The Podcast is celebrating by taking a look back in time to one of the greatest athletic years in Valparaiso history. The football and volleyball teams will be celebrating a pair of 20-year anniversaries this weekend. Couple the Pioneer Football League title and a NCAA tournament appearance for the volleyball team with a pair of trips to the Big Dance for the men’s and women’s basketball teams and one can argue that 2003-04 was the greatest year in Valpo history.

Aaron Leavitt, Valparaiso’s longtime assistant athletic director for Media Relations, joins the pod to discuss the 2003-04 seasons and what it was like to be on campus on Nov. 22, 2003, the day when football won the PFL title game and volleyball won the Mid-Continent Conference tournament.
